    Reduce condensation

    Condensation of double-glazed windows is a problem that a lot of homeowners have to deal with. Luckily, there are ways to tackle it and ensure your home remains warm and comfortable.

    First, you must keep the temperature in your house at a steady temperature. This will help reduce the moisture levels and stop mold from growing. double glazed front doors birmingham keeps your windows from getting damp. door specialists birmingham is also recommended to make use of an extractor fan to rid the room of any excess moisture.

    Additionally, you must make sure that the windows are airtight. A broken seal can cause condensation and other issues. If you are concerned that your windows aren't working as they should, it may be the best idea to replace them.

    Double glazing units are made to help in insulating. Therefore, they can keep temperatures that are lower than a single-panel window. However, they are still susceptible to condensation, especially if seals are damaged or if the spacer bar is defective.

    Condensation happens most often when the outside temperature is greater than the inside of the glass pane. If you consume cold drinks outside on a cold winter day condensation will develop on the glass's exterior. The humidity could also increase if there is not enough airflow.

    However, if you've examined the seals and find no issue, the cause of the condensation may not be the window. Condensation in windows that are internal could be a sign of a more serious issue. Insufficient ventilation or excessive moisture are the main causes of internal window condensation.

    Alternatively, you might need to look at the air gap of the window unit. The silica in the sealant can become hard over time, making it less able to absorb moisture.

    Last a lifetime

    A window that lasts a lifetime can be a great investment. With proper care and maintenance, you can extend the lifespan of your windows. The quality of your house and the materials used to construct double-glazed windows will determine their lifespan.

    Double-glazed windows and doors could last between 10 to 35 years. It all depends on the material, how it's installed, and what the weather conditions. If you live in a harsh climate or have an older house, it is a good idea to shade your windows to stop cracking.

    Wooden windows are a popular option for many homeowners. They're not as sturdy as vinyl or aluminum, however. They will need to be replaced around 15 to 20 years.

    UPVC is a sturdy material however, it can warp. To prevent warping, make sure to clean your uPVC properly. You can also use an anti-warping sealant to keep water out of your window.

    Some window manufacturers offer transferable warranties on their products. Some warranties don't cover the cost of labor. A warranty will allow you to replace defective parts.

    Insulated glass units are susceptible to failure during the warranty period. This is because the gas inside the panes can leak out. The transfer of heat through glass is deterred by inert gas like argon and krypton.
